Add 49/2 and 4/54
1st number: 24 1/2, 2nd number: 4/54
49/2 + 4/54 is 1327/54.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 2 and 54 is 54
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 54 - For the 1st fraction, since 2 × 27 = 54,
49/2 = 49 × 27/2 × 27 = 1323/54 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 54 × 1 = 54,
4/54 = 4 × 1/54 × 1 = 4/54 - Add the two like fractions:
1323/54 + 4/54 = 1323 + 4/54 = 1327/54 - So, 49/2 + 4/54 = 1327/54
